| UNH
Hosts U.S. Senate committee hearing on oceans Sept. 27
UNH
will host the U.S. Senate Appropriations Committee’s Subcommittee
on Commerce, Justice, State and Judiciary field hearing on the U.S.
Commission on Ocean Policy report Monday, Sept. 27. It is scheduled
to take place at 10 a.m. in Room 501 of Dimond Library.
(09-17-04)

Finally
Home: Professor and students help reunite African family
Children
from the Congo separated from their parents for more than two years
because of civil war were reunited with their parents Friday, Sept.
10, thanks in large part to a year-long effort by a UNH anthropology
professor and her students, who were determined to bring the family
back together. (09-17-04) More
